LITE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

482 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Lumentum (LITE)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$7.96B — up 58% from $5.04B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 109 funds opened new LITE positions and 41 closed out — a net gain of 68 holders — while 171 added to existing stakes and 132 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Polar Capital Holdings, adding an estimated $105M. The largest seller was Point72 Asset Management, cutting an estimated $215M.
